Pull request overview
This PR addresses bug APL-1412 by adding missing ACL schema declarations and replacing the isGiteaURL helper function with a direct string comparison against the cluster domain suffix.
- Adds
x-aclSchema: Workloadto three API endpoints that were missing ACL schema declarations - Replaces
isGiteaURL()function calls with explicit URL comparison usingclusterDomainSuffixparameter - Threads the
clusterDomainSuffixparameter through the workload utility functions
Reviewed changes
Copilot reviewed 3 out of 3 changed files in this pull request and generated 3 comments.
| File | Description |
|---|---|
| src/openapi/api.yaml | Adds missing x-aclSchema: Workload declarations to workload catalog endpoints |
| src/utils/workloadUtils.ts | Updates URL validation from isGiteaURL() to explicit domain suffix comparison |
| src/otomi-stack.ts | Passes cluster?.domainSuffix to workload functions and normalizes import ordering |
